RWK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

31 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co S&P MidCap 400 Revenue ETF (RWK)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$76M — up 3.9% from $73.1M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 3 funds opened new RWK positions and 2 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 5 added to existing stakes and 15 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Susquehanna International Group, adding an estimated $3.35M. The largest seller was UBS Group, cutting an estimated $3.44M.
